Phil Housley, Brian Burke, and Bob Naegele all grew up playing hockey on the frozen lakes of Minnesota. That trio, joined by Hall of Famer Ted Lindsay, will receive the 2008 Lester Patrick Award for service to hockey in the United States.

It's been 20 years since the stunning trade that sent Wayne Gretzky to the Los Angeles Kings from the Edmonton Oilers, but "The Great One" remembers the deal like it was yesterday. Gretzky trade package | Trade quotes | Anatomy of a deal
